    Welcome to Club PERO! Our Rhythmic Gymnastics programs are held at three locations in Sydney: SCEGGS Darlinghurst, TARA Anglican School for Girls in North Parramatta and Tangara School for Girls in Cherrybrook. We offer Foundational and Competition streams with classes to fit all students of all ages. Our programs are aimed at developing strength, flexibility, hand-eye coordination, spatial awareness and music appreciation with Rhythmic Gymnastics apparatus including Rope, Hoop, Ball, Clubs and Ribbon.
